|
ru.unix- RU.UNIX ---------------------------------------------------------------------- From : Alexander Gottlieb 2:5080/1003 08 Jun 2007 11:08:14 To : All Subject : Обновил самбу на свою голову... :-( --------------------------------------------------------------------------------
Система FreeBSD 6.2. Стоит cyrus-imapd-2.3.1, который настроен на
аутентификацию почтовых пользователей через cyrus-sasl-saslauthd,
которые в свою очередь настроен на аутентификацию через PAM. Все из портов.
В /etc/pam.d/imap прописан pam_winbind:
auth sufficient /usr/local/lib/pam_winbind.so debug
auth required pam_unix.so no_warn
try_first_pass
account sufficient /usr/local/lib/pam_winbind.so debug
Все работало замечательно до апгрейда сабмы (стояла 3.0.22). Hе нравилось
что переодически демон винбинда без всяких видимих причин помирал и приходилось
его время от времени перезапускать (в момент перезапуска он некоторое время был
не функционален).
Обновил через порты самбу до 3.0.25а и pam_winbind перестал писать логи.
Раньше он через syslogd без всяких дополнительных настроек писал в
/var/log/auth.log:
// при успешной аутентификации
Jun 7 15:00:18 relay2 pam_winbind[608]: Verify user `username'
Jun 7 15:00:18 relay2 pam_winbind[608]: user 'username' granted access
// и при неуспешной
Jun 7 19:29:10 relay2 pam_winbind[787]: Verify user `baduser'
Jun 7 19:29:10 relay2 pam_winbind[787]: request failed: No such user,
PAM error was 13, NT error was NT_STATUS_NO_SUCH_USER
Jun 7 19:29:10 relay2 pam_winbind[787]: user `baduser' not found
и т.п.
Сейчас вообще ничего не пишет. Hи при успешной аутентификации, ни при
неуспешной. Hо работает.
Еще заметил проблему. После обновления до 3.0.25а винбинд начал в свой
лог вот так вот ругаться:
/var/log/samba/log.winbindd
[2007/06/08 10:02:02, 0] nsswitch/winbindd.c:request_len_recv(544)
request_len_recv: Invalid request size received: 1836
[2007/06/08 10:02:02, 0] nsswitch/winbindd.c:request_len_recv(544)
request_len_recv: Invalid request size received: 1836
[2007/06/08 10:02:06, 0] nsswitch/winbindd.c:request_len_recv(544)
request_len_recv: Invalid request size received: 1836
[2007/06/08 10:02:06, 0] nsswitch/winbindd.c:request_len_recv(544)
request_len_recv: Invalid request size received: 1836
[2007/06/08 10:02:08, 0] nsswitch/winbindd.c:request_len_recv(544)
request_len_recv: Invalid request size received: 1836
[2007/06/08 10:02:08, 0] nsswitch/winbindd.c:request_len_recv(544)
request_len_recv: Invalid request size received: 1836
При этом опять же внешне вроде бы все в порядке, работает. Заметил это
на всех серверах, где 3.0.25а стоит (предыдущие версиями там разные
3.0.21, 3.0.22, 3.0.23 были).
В чем дело может быть? Как починить?
--
WBR, Alexander B. Gottlieb, mailto:alex@cca.usart.ru
ICQ: 13043204 / Jabber: alex@jabber.usurt.ru
-|- -|-
--- slrn/0.9.7.4 (CYGWIN_NT-5.2)
* Origin: (http://news.cca.usart.ru/) USURT's FidoNET<->Internet (2:5080/1003)
Вернуться к списку тем, сортированных по: возрастание даты уменьшение даты тема автор
Архивное /ru.unix/56667141a4174.html, оценка из 5, голосов 10
|